Summer Concerts and Dining in Newport Beach

Great weather this summer means outdoor music and an array of dining options. Last week we had a chance to enjoy some great music under the stars in the intimate amphitheater at The Hyatt Regency Newport Beach for their Summer Concert Series. The series will run 15 weeks and is celebrating it’s 20th anniversary offering up a stellar line-up of musicians bringing a range of genres to the stage including jazz, smooth jazz, contemporary, acoustic and vocals. As the longest running music series in California, and recognized for bringing revered musicians to southern California every year, the series continues every Friday through September 30 with all shows at 8 p.m.
We started the evening with on of Newport’s finest new establishments, Sol Cocina. We were in a hurry so we sat in the bar and enjoyed an array of their signature a la carte street tacos with a hefty portion of their home made guacamole.

We then head to The Hyatt which was less then a 5 minute drive Sol. A full yet smaller sized audience watched as the sun set behind the stage and musicians Mindi Abair, Jeff Golub and David Pack came together to take us through an evening of smooth Jazz. What a treat it was!
